    So you can use a apartment lock to jam your door shut if your in an apartment or a shared rental.
    You can carry a super bright flashlight that helps alot.
    You can take an airhorn and tie the push down part to the doorknob so if door is opened the air horn goes with it.
    A Whistle, LOUD one.
    I'm from chicagoland so.... Metal softball bats are real.... Motivating. Have one in your car or house.
    First Aid kit.
    Multitools can make great protection devices.
    Don't forget the ol jamming a chair under a door knob.

I am answering this from the perspective of a voice actor, having been on live streams where this kind of back and forth occured, used a mic to teach groups of people, and having taken classes on post production of audio... Lapel mics require more of a setup and kind of "training" to be "mindful" of so you're not bumping and brushing against it. (Not that I haven't bumped a boom mic before) But you have more freedom to move around and still have quality audio. Often these set ups are plug and play and that makes them easier to use.
